USDA Vs. FHA Pro and Con comparison in Enterprise, Coffee County, AL
In 2025, USDA loan limit in Enterprise, county of Coffee, AL is $336,500 while FHA limit is $472,030 for a single-family home.

USDA home loan is a loan guaranteed by the government Department of Agriculture AKA USDA rural development loan or USDA mortgage and is available in rural neighborhoods only. Unlike FHA loans that require a minimum of 3.5% down payment, the USDA mortgage loan does not require any down payment.
